Dr. Paul T. Khoury, board-certified in Diagnostic Radiology and Nuclear Medicine, is the Chief of Radiology at White Plains Hospital. Dr. Khoury received his medical degree from the Faculty of Medicine at the Université Saint-Joseph de Beyrouth (USJ) in Beirut, Lebanon. He then completed an internship and residency in diagnostic radiology and fellowship in Nuclear Medicine at the Hôtel-Dieu de France Medical Center in Beirut, after which he completed a second residency in diagnostic radiology at Roosevelt Hospital (now Mount Sinai West).

After serving as an attending physician at Roosevelt Hospital, Dr. Khoury was named Chief of Radiology at White Plains Hospital, after which he ran the Radiology department in the Stellaris Network: White Plains Hospital, Phelps Memorial Hospital, Northern Westchester and Lawrence Hospital. He also ran the Radiology department at Our Lady of Mercy, St Barnabas in The Bronx, and St John’s Hospital in Yonkers
